Depends what motor you will be running. The 40c Thunderpowers are badassed in 17.5. I've tested back to back 40c vs the 50c and I prefer the 40c. It provides more punch with the same top end in 17.5, at least.
I also tried a 40c SMC and the Thunderpower (which was over a year and a half old) totally outclassed it.
50c is best used in high draw situations (mod). Because the higher winds don't draw as much amperage, the potential of a 50c can never be realized whereas the 40c works much better.

50c@5000mAh = approx 250A. Isnt that getting into specs that can never be realised in RC ??
Even to gain the claimed discharge rate of 40C would require some really hefty wiring- which is why Hyperion state NEVER to attempt to use/discharge at its rated C.
So why is 50C,40C needed ???
